Robots can plan, but rarely improvise. How do we move beyond pick-and-place to multi-object, improvisational manipulation without giving up completeness guarantees?
We introduce Shortcut Learning for Abstract Planning (SLAP), a new method that uses reinforcement learning (RL) to discover shortcuts in the planning graphs induced by task and motion planning (TAMP) skill libraries. It is a plug-and-play module that can be trained on top of existing planners to speed up execution through learned shortcuts.

Splines instead of Gaussians ๐ Introducing Neural Spline Fields, which can see through occlusions!
We learn to represent a stack of misaligned captures as a multi-layer image sandwich. Then you can extract your favorite layer to remove occlusions, reflections, or even your own shadows from the scene!
